For poor urban communities, access to affordable and nutritious food can be a daily struggle. In this episode of Old-School, hear from award-winning educator Stephen Ritz about his urban farming initiative in the South Brox in New York City, where he and his students have grown more than 165,000 pounds of vegetables to feed their community.
